  5. Drainage and erosion control Johnson City gets heavy rain, and poor drainage causes real damage over time. A proper hardscape design accounts for water flow from the start keeping runoff away from your foundation and your neighbor’s yard. When drainage isn’t planned into the design, you end up with pooling water, eroded soil, and in worse cases, water working its way toward your home’s foundation. We look at the natural slope of your property during the design phase and make sure every surface whether it’s a retaining wall, walkway, or stone border directs water where it’s supposed to go.

  7. Built to last We use stone, brick, and concrete rated for Tennessee’s freeze-thaw cycles. A hardscape design done right doesn’t need to be redone in five years. The freeze-thaw cycle is one of the biggest reasons hardscape installations fail prematurely in this region. Water gets into small gaps, freezes, expands, and slowly pushes things out of place. We use materials and installation methods specifically chosen to handle that proper base depth, the right jointing sand, and materials with low water absorption rates.

What materials do you use for hardscape design?

We work with natural stone, concrete pavers, brick, and poured concrete depending on your budget, style, and how the space will be used. Each material has its strengths: natural stone looks the most organic and ages well, pavers are the easiest to repair, and poured concrete is cost-effective for large flat areas. We’ll walk you through the tradeoffs and recommend what makes the most sense for your specific project.
